Transaction 02d5b7858e258d60d7c8aef358cd408819f7b922257a82d265c3e42e4b5de714
1 Input
2 Outputs
- 02d5b7858e258d60d7c8aef358cd408819f7b922257a82d265c3e42e4b5de714:0
- 02d5b7858e258d60d7c8aef358cd408819f7b922257a82d265c3e42e4b5de714:1
value 120253969
address 1B2sHA6pw2wYKtECzFPPHzcem6AgcsE5xB
value 38950000
address 39Z7VWiYKT3ZNdKzETU6yva7vjxrA93jmk